Pergolas built for Cascade-Chipita Park homes

Pergolas add structure and dappled shade to Cascade-Chipita Park outdoor spaces without closing them in. We build freestanding pergolas over patios and integrated pergolas over decks — cedar and Douglas fir for a warm timber look, powder-coated aluminum for a low-maintenance modern read that suits newer mountain cabins.

At 7,420 ft with significant sustained wind, pergola posts need real footings and lateral bracing — we build ours for Cascade-Chipita Park's conditions, not to a big-box kit spec. Optional louvered tops give you full sun-to-shade control on your short winter sun window — south and west decks get the most usable hours lot.

Built for the Front Range

Why Cascade-Chipita Park pergolas need to be built differently

Building a long-lasting pergolas in Cascade-Chipita Park isn't the same as building one in Dallas or Phoenix. Our crews engineer every project for Colorado's specific climate: deep frost line, heavy spring snow load, hail, and brutal year-round UV at altitude. Footings are sized and poured below the local frost depth, ledger boards are flashed properly to keep meltwater off your siding, and every fastener is rated for the temperature swings we get from October through April.

We also know the local permit offices. Whether your Cascade-Chipita Park home falls under El Paso County, Teller County, or a city building department, we pull the right permit the first time, meet the inspector on-site, and pass inspection — so you don't end up with a deck you can't legally use.

  • Snow & wind load engineering

    Substructure sized for our actual snow load and 90+ mph design winds.

  • Frost-depth footings

    Concrete piers poured below frost line so your deck doesn't heave in spring.

  • UV-rated finishes

    Stains and sealers selected for high-altitude UV — not the generic big-box products.

  • Hail-tolerant materials

    Composite and aluminum options chosen for hail performance, not just looks.

  • Wildfire-aware detailing

    WUI-conscious construction details for foothill and forested lots.

Pergolas FAQs — Cascade-Chipita Park

+ Do pergolas hold up in Cascade-Chipita Park's wind?

Ours are built for it — significant sustained wind. We anchor and brace pergolas for local conditions rather than to a big-box kit spec.

+ Wood or aluminum pergola for Cascade-Chipita Park?

Cedar and Douglas fir give a warm timber look that fits mountain cabins well. Powder-coated aluminum needs little maintenance and handles high UV without fading — a smart pick at 7,420 ft.

+ Can you add a louvered top to a Cascade-Chipita Park pergola?

Yes. Adjustable louvered tops open for full sun and close in seconds when clouds turn — very useful in Cascade-Chipita Park's afternoon-storm pattern.

+ Can I attach a pergola to my existing Cascade-Chipita Park deck?

Usually yes — but the deck substructure has to support the added load. We inspect first and reinforce the frame or add drop posts to grade if needed.

+ How does a pergola work with the the Pikes Peak Highway entrance view?

A well-placed pergola frames the view rather than blocking it. We orient the beams and rafters to keep sightlines open from your main seating area.
